We investigated the impact of eukaryotic parasite infection on the composition and diversity of the gut microbiome in a cohort of 258 dogs. We sequenced the V4 region of the 16S rRNA gene to profile fecal samples of uninfected dogs (n=145), dogs infected with a single parasite (n=92), and dogs infected with multiple parasites (n=21). Parasites were detected as part of both sick and wellness visits and from dogs used in the spay clinic. Fecal samples were examined for parasites by fecal flotation at the Clinical Parasitology Laboratory of the University of Pennsylvania's Ryan Veterinary Hospital. Parasites detected included the protozoan parasites Giardia (n=32) and Cystoisospora (n=12), and helminths including hookworm (Ancylostoma caninum) (n=19), whipworm (Trichuris vulpis) (n=12), ascarid (Toxocara canis) (n=9), tapeworm (Dipylidium caninum) (n=5), and Eucoleus boehmi (n=3).
